M.A.I., APETRO, ANAREC and TELECEL announce a " Security in Service Stations " Agreement

The Ministry of Internal Affairs, the Portuguese Association of Petrol Companies (APETRO), the National Association of Fuel Sellers (ANAREC) and Telecel signed an agreement yesterday to focus on reducing crimes committed at service stations. Service stations are often prime targets for criminals due to their location and opening hours.

Under the terms of the agreement, Telecel will supply the communications equipment for interaction between the individual service station and the police headquarters, for use in emergencies.

This system, called “Communication system for the security of service stations”, uses a direct connection, via the Telecel network, between service stations and police headquarters, which allows the immediate identification of the emergency situation by the authorities.
